My current creature is a Toucan, commonly found in the rainforest. The toucan has colorful feathers to attract a mate and to blend into its lush environment. He is not great at flying so he has short legs and long claws to perch on trees. His long beak helps him get deep into tree holes to find food. His large beak helps him self regulate his temperature by releasing or absorbing heat. My future creature, called a Sandcan, has earthy colors to blend in with his drier desert surroundings. His thin body uses up less water and his larger eyes help him focus better at night in order to find food. Longer legs keep this bird further from the hot ground during the day. His scaly legs prevent burns and protect his feet from sharp rocks and hot sand while his beak can reach deep into cacti.
